What is in the box

Exploded view of the ERA box: lid, tray holding the ERA, round charging pad, three ERA Recovery Cards, and the box base.
Photo: What is in the box, top to bottom: the lid, the tray with the ERA, the wireless charging pad, three ERA Recovery Cards, and the box.
  • ERA hardware wallet (e-ink touch screen with front light, camera on the back, one hardware button under the screen; bank-card size, 54 × 87 × 5.5 mm, 45 g; IP67 water and dust resistant) Source: era-wallet.com

  • Wireless charging pad (magnetic, plugs into any USB power adapter — adapter not included). Charging is wireless only; the device has no cable port. Source: era-wallet.com, Help Center

  • 3 ERA Recovery Cards (NFC backup cards) Source: era-wallet.com

  • Paper Recovery sheet

  • Quick-start leaflet

Steps

  1. Press and hold the hardware button for 5 seconds. The screen wakes up and tells you what to do next; on a new device it shows PRESS TO TURN ON.

The screen says "Place the device on the charging pad to turn it on"

Devices shipped with the older firmware wake up on the charging pad instead of the button. Put the ERA on the pad, screen up, with the pad connected to a USB power adapter; it switches on by itself. Whatever your device shows, the screen tells you which of the two to do. Source: Help Center

Note: The firmware update in the next step refuses to start below 40 %, and a full battery carries you through the whole setup.

  1. Charge the ERA fully before the setup: put it on the charging pad, screen up, and connect the pad to a USB power adapter. Source: Help Center

  2. The screen shows the battery level and CHARGING. We strongly advise leaving the ERA on the pad until it reads 100%; this also confirms that the pad and the battery work.

  3. Take the ERA off the pad. The camera does not work while the device sits on the pad, and the setup uses the camera. The device shows CHECK FOR UPDATES; continue with the next step, Update the firmware. Source: Help Center

Using the hardware button

  • Short press while the device is unlocked: locks the screen. The device shows PRESS TO UNLOCK; press again to get the PIN screen.

  • Press and hold: opens the power menu with TURN OFF, REBOOT and BACK.

Note: While the ERA sits on the charging pad, the hardware button does nothing. Tap the touchscreen instead; take the device off the pad when you need the button.

Trouble?

  • The screen stays blank after pressing the button → hold the button for a full 5 seconds. If nothing happens, put the ERA on the powered charging pad: older firmware wakes up on the pad, and an empty battery needs about 10 minutes of charge before the screen comes on. Source: Help Center

  • The device shows LOW BATTERY → charge it before you continue; the update and the wallet setup need charge.

  • The e-ink screen looks faded or shows a ghost of the last screen → this is normal for e-ink; the next full refresh clears it.
